I had a problem with this hostel because I did not sleep; which is was vital for a traveler especially on day 1 with jet lag.
No only was there no soap or paper towels in the lady's bathroom for the entire period of our stay... but it was hot (on May 1st, not a very hot time of year, but hot room and hostel...), there were no in room lockers or storage, and the building is essentially attached to the public train, or tram. It went by during the day between every 5 to 8 minutes, and during the night was less frequent. It was extremely loud, and the building (at least on the 4th floor) would shake slightly as it went by.
The staff was amazing, pleasant, and helpful when relevant.
